tech lectures // auditorium
12:30 scaling eve online
  Davíð H. Brandt [Papa Smurf] (Senior Network Programmer) covers EVE’s scalable server architecture and how the unique singleshard concept is implemented. The issues of server lag and responsiveness are discussed, as well as scalability, stability, distributed programming, multicasting, session distribution and load balancing.
13:30 holy hardware batman! that’s a lot of bits
  Kristján V. Jónsson [Zardoz] (Senior Programmer). It is getting harder for the CPU makers to pimp out more megahertz. The future lies in dual-core and multi-core CPU’s as well as upgrading from 32 bit to 64. Kristján explains how.

Q: Do I need a passport?
A: Don't leave home without it. Although Iceland is part of the Schengen agreement, many hotels and airlines require passports for authentication.

Q: Is there an age restrictions to the fanfest?
A: Events are restricted to 18 years due to Icelandic Alcohol laws.
